I've recently bought a "version 3" gateway, the type that has a USB socket for power rather than plugging stright into the wall. I'm running xiaomi-mqtt and see the start "xiaomi-mqtt started." message but nothing after that. On using tcpdump, I don't see any multicast messages coming out of the gateway, but instead see a broadcast every 90 seconds to port 54321 with 32 bytes in a UDP packet.

I see that this version was mentioned in another thread and wonder if you might have a working theory as to how to proceed? I'm more than happy to provide further debug info if you can tell me what's needed.
